Output eda6fe328fbf09304d604d610b4add67aa47169c64ecf44a10927d42e698e851:39

value
1005610
script pubkey
OP_0 OP_PUSHBYTES_20 8503c1f2708901c542f367f6c195ce6e80c3ec97
address
bc1qs5puruns3yqu2shnvlmvr9wwd6qv8myher4ad7
transaction
eda6fe328fbf09304d604d610b4add67aa47169c64ecf44a10927d42e698e851